What is a Self Portrait?

• A self-portrait is a representation of an artist; drawn, painted, photographed, or sculpted by the artist.

What’s the point?Self portraits let us express who we are and how we feel. Some

people find it hard to talk about how they feel so they are able to express it through art forms, like music, dance, writing, drawing, painting, and sculpture. How do you express yourself?

Vincent Van Gogh

• One of the most famous of self-portraitists was Vincent Van Gogh, who painted himself 37 times in 3 years. Van Gogh rarely painted himself looking at the viewer, why do you think that is?

Frida Kahlo

• Frida Kahlo also painted many self portraits. Due to a terrible accident she spent many years bedridden, with only herself for a model. She painted 55 self-portraits. Some are nightmarish representations which symbolize her physical sufferings.
